WebJun 23, 2024 · These are the caffeine contents of various types of chocolate, according to the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Food Data 3. Each one represents a standard serving size (1 ounce) of chocolate. Dark chocolate (70 to 85% cacao solids): 22.7 milligrams. Dark chocolate (45 to 59% cacao solids): 12.2 milligrams. WebCandy and sweets with chocolate in them will contain both theobromine and caffeine. These chemicals may disrupt sleep in sufficient quantities, and such a disruption could lead to nightmares.
